The 2025 world average of #WomenMPs in #parliaments is 2️⃣7️⃣.2️⃣%.

Regionally, the Middle East and North Africa have just 16.7% representation, whereas the Americas has 35.4%.

Women's representation in #parliaments worldwide has climbed from 11.3% in 1995 to 2️⃣7️⃣.2️⃣% in 2025.
But in recent years, progress has slowed down and, in some parliaments, the number of #WomenMPs had gone backwards.

Auschwitz was at the end of a long process. It did not start from gas chambers.

This hatred was gradually developed by humans. From ideas, words, stereotypes & prejudice through legal exclusion, dehumanization & escalating violence... to systematic and industrial murder.

Auschwitz took time.
